Problem Management: Superior Practices for Your Workforce

Successfully addressing issues is crucial for maintaining project progress and providing high-quality deliverables. To support a efficient workflow , adopt these critical optimal practices . First, develop a clear documentation method for locating and logging snags . This needs to include a consistent template and allocate responsibility for the point. In addition, prioritize issues based on their severity and immediacy .

Ultimately, a proactive problem solution strategy leads to increased efficiency and reduced task risks .
